VIDEO: IPOB Stages Protest in UK Amid Tinubu’s Visit

Members of the Indigenous People of Biafra, IPOB, have staged a protest in the United Kingdom amid President Bola Tinubu’s state visit, calling for the immediate release of their leader, Mazi Nnamdi Kanu.

The demonstrators gathered at key locations across London, including Parliament Square, 10 Downing Street, the Commonwealth Office and the Nigerian High Commission.

In a video circulating online, a protester was heard saying, “Our message is very clear: Tinubu does not deserve a royal salute. That is our stand today, being the 18th of March.”

Protesters were seen holding placards with the inscription, ‘Free Mazi Nnamdi Kanu’.

Many wore red caps and waved Biafra flags, a horizontal tricolour of red, black, and green, featuring a golden rising sun at the centre of the black strip.
